I. Ecological Raw Material Revolution: The Transformation from "Waste" to "High Value Resources"
The global environmental protection industry is undergoing a cognitive upheaval - plant extracts have risen from traditional "auxiliary ingredients" to the core engine of green transformation. Agricultural residues, wild herbs, and even invasive plants, once overlooked resources, are being revitalized through extraction techniques
1. Peel and pomace: Limonene extracted from citrus peel replaces petrochemical solvents and is used as an industrial cleaning agent, reducing toxicity by 90%; The bioplastic film made from grape seed residue naturally degrades within 6 months and has a strength comparable to polyethylene.
2. Invasive plants: Phoenix eye blue (water hyacinth) extracts polysaccharides to make heavy metal adsorbents, with an adsorption efficiency of over 90% for lead and cadmium, becoming a new favorite in sewage treatment.
3. Medicinal plant waste: The ginseng residue extracted from ginsenosides is fermented and converted into biochar, which can adsorb PM2.5 particles in the air and greatly improve purification efficiency.

II.Technological Breakthrough: The 'Dual Evolution' of Nature and Technology
Plant extraction technology is no longer limited to "extraction", but deeply integrated with ecological laws:
Biomimetic intelligent extraction: Simulating plant stress resistance mechanisms, stimulating mint to release more Antioxidant components at specific sound frequencies.
Microbial co transformation: Using gene edited yeast to decompose lignin into high-purity vanillin, avoiding strong acid and alkali pollution in traditional processes.
Zero waste closed-loop system: An innovative process extracts lavender essential oil, anthocyanins, and cellulose simultaneously, and converts the residue into biogas for energy supply, improving resource utilization efficiency.
These technological breakthroughs have given rise to a new generation of "active materials": natural latex extracted from dandelion roots, with elasticity comparable to synthetic rubber; The food packaging film made from seaweed extract can automatically display color warning when encountering pollutants, subverting the traditional quality inspection mode.

III. Penetration of the Entire Industry Chain: The 'Green Relay' from Fields to Cities
Plant extracts are restructuring every aspect of the environmental protection industry:
1. Agricultural production end: A biopesticide made from castor oil extract that targets and kills harmful insects but is harmless to bees. Field experiments have shown an increase in ecological diversity.
2. Industrial production end: Tea polyphenols replace chromium salts in tanning leather, completely eliminating hexavalent chromium pollution in the leather industry and reducing wastewater toxicity to drinking water standards.
3. Consumer end: Natural preservatives containing rosemary extract extend the shelf life of pre made dishes to 180 days without the need for nitrite addition.
4. Urban governance end: The urban haze adsorbent developed from duckweed extract can purify 300 cubic meters of air per day when sprayed on the exterior walls of buildings.
